С помощью этого запроса можно получить информацию о всех сериях, к которым привязаны книги персоны. Например, можно получить информацию о всех сериях, в которых встречаются книги Сергея Лукьяненко.
ID функции
r_browse_person_sequences
Кто может вызывать
Любой пользователь
Авторизованное приложение
Принимаемые параметры
id – идентификатор персоны, для книг которой осуществляется поиск по сериям.
top_n_arts, top_genres, descr – идентично одноименным параметрам из запроса r_search_sequences.
Возвращаемые значения
sequences* – массив, содержащий информацию о запрошенных сериях. Содержимое идентично описанному в r_search_sequences (за исключением не актуального здесь параметра match_weight).
Если не было найдено ни одной серии с запрошенными ID, то массив sequences будет пустым.
Возможные ошибки
error_code | error_message | Описание |
---|---|---|
101075 | Недопустимое значение в топе по книгам | В параметре top_n_arts допустимы только целые положительные числа от 1 до 10. |
101076 | Недопустимое значение в топе по жанрам | В параметре top_n_genres допустимы только целые положительные числа от 1 до 10. |
101081 | Некорректный флаг описания | В параметре descr указано значение, отличное от «1». |
Пример запроса на сервер
{ "app": "1", "time": "2014-11-07T16:21:02+03:00", "sha": "b79d8e9993d20da6abe78838d3c7fbf640a4c52956569bef3c685d3453316b5c", "sid": "7bad5f2fb752ee957a4ab74aaac7711g", "requests": [ { "func": "r_browse_person_sequences", "id": "browse_persons_series", "param": { "id": "100500", "top_n_arts": "3", "top_n_genres": "3", "descr": "1" } } ] }
Пример ответа сервера
{ "success": true, "time": "2014-11-07T16:21:02+03:00", "browse_person_sequences" : { "success" : true, "sequences" : [ { "id": "100500", "name": "Пушкин. Лучшее.", "arts_n": "32", "reviews_n": "22", "description_html": "<p>Описание серии </p>", "top_arts": [ { "id": "8604574", "name": "Сказки Пушкина", "cover": "https://www.litres.ru/pub/c/cover/11399521.jpg", "marks": "9.9" }, { ... } ], "top_genres": [ { "id": "193", "name": "Поэзия" }, { ... } ]}, { ... } ... ] } }